| Climate Papua New Guinea :
| tropical; northwest monsoon (December to March), southeast monsoon (May to October); slight seasonal temperature variation
|
| Terrain Papua New Guinea :
| mostly mountains with coastal lowlands and rolling foothills
|
| Elevation extremes lowest Papua New Guinea :
| Pacific Ocean 0 m
|
| Elevation extremes highest Papua New Guinea :
| Mount Wilhelm 4,509 m
|
| Natural resources Papua New Guinea :
| gold, copper, silver, natural gas, timber, oil, fisheries
|
| Land use arableland Papua New Guinea :
| 0,46%
|
| Irrigated land Papua New Guinea :
| NA sq km
|
| Natural hazards Papua New Guinea :
| active volcanism; situated along the Pacific "Ring of Fire"; the country is subject to frequent and sometimes severe earthquakes; mud slides; tsunamis
|
| Environment current issues Papua New Guinea :
| rain forest subject to deforestation as a result of growing commercial demand for tropical timber; pollution from mining projects; severe drought
|
| Geography note Papua New Guinea :
| shares island of New Guinea with Indonesia; one of world's largest swamps along southwest coast
